[jira] [Created] (GROOVY-9288) Compilation error when accessing a protected super class field from inside a closure

             Summary: Compilation error when accessing a protected super class field from inside a closure
                 Key: GROOVY-9288
                 URL: https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/GROOVY-9288
             Project: Groovy
          Issue Type: Bug
          Components: Static compilation
    Affects Versions: 2.5.8, 2.5.7
            Reporter: John Bellassai


The following code works fine in 2.5.6 but breaks in 2.5.7 and 2.5.8:
{code:java}
GroovyShell shell = new GroovyShell()
shell.evaluate('''
    package a
    
    import groovy.transform.CompileStatic
    
    @CompileStatic
    abstract class Abstract_Class {
        protected String protectedField = 'field'
        
        abstract String doThing()
    }
    assert true''')

shell.evaluate('''
    package b
    
    import a.Abstract_Class
    import groovy.transform.CompileStatic
    
    @CompileStatic
    class ConcreteClass extends Abstract_Class {
       
        @Override
        String doThing() {
            'something'.with {
                return protectedField
            }
        }
    }
    assert true''')

shell.evaluate("assert new b.ConcreteClass().doThing() == 'field'")
{code}
{noformat}
org.codehaus.groovy.control.MultipleCompilationErrorsException: startup failed:
Script2.groovy: 13: Access to a.Abstract_Class#protectedField is forbidden @ line 13, column 32.
                           return protectedField
                                  ^
{noformat}
If you change both classes to be in the same package, you get an error like this:
{noformat}
tried to access field a.Abstract_Class.protectedField from class a.ConcreteClass$_doThing_closure1
java.lang.IllegalAccessError: tried to access field a.Abstract_Class.protectedField from class a.ConcreteClass$_doThing_closure1
{noformat}
